Output 8d087806749899330c62d6693e31e60399c6fc20dc1dbb3ebe44f45adbec4361:0

value
85173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224dafe9fa616d96b1a6f2a1ab704b92e737cc67 OP_EQUAL
address
34pPxs7Ln8MY7rDow9Y5cA6KUdPsQGzXMA
transaction
8d087806749899330c62d6693e31e60399c6fc20dc1dbb3ebe44f45adbec4361
confirmations
173886
spent
true